The Dark Tower

The Dark Tower series is an epic journey woven with the threads of fantasy, horror, and Western motifs. Spanning multiple worlds and following the enigmatic gunslinger Roland Deschain, the narrative seeks the titular Dark Tower, the nexus of all universes. Through desolate landscapes and confrontations with personal demons, the series explores themes of destiny, sacrifice, and the eternal battle between good and evil. Stephen King's magnum opus invites readers into a complex, ever-expanding universe that challenges the boundaries of genre and storytelling.
1. The Gunslinger2. The Drawing of the Three3. The Waste Lands4. Wizard and Glass5. Wolves of the Calla6. Song of Susannah7. The Dark Tower

The Shining

In The Shining series, terror unfolds within the eerie walls of the Overlook Hotel, where the Torrance family's winter caretaker stay spirals into a harrowing psychic onslaught. Jack, Wendy, and their son, Danny, who possesses 'the shining,' a psychic ability, must confront the hotel's malevolent forces. This chilling saga explores the depths of madness, the bonds of family, and the costs of past sins returning to haunt the present.
1. The Shining2. Doctor Sleep
